In this edition of the DF Direct Q&A, the team discussed a variety of gaming and tech topics beginning with the performance prospects of Call of Duty Modern Warfare 4 on the Nintendo Switch 2. The consensus was cautiously optimistic, noting that while the Switch 2 is less powerful than current Xbox and PlayStation consoles, the game engine’s scalability and past experience with ports like Resident Evil Requiem suggest a decent experience is possible. The key considerations highlighted were the game’s graphical scaling, frame rate targets (potentially 60fps), and the challenges of playing fast-paced shooters like Call of Duty on a smaller, portable screen.
The conversation then shifted to Nvidia’s newly announced RTX Spark, a Windows on ARM device aimed at AI workloads and gaming. While the hardware, especially the GPU and memory, appeared promising for AI applications, skepticism remained about its gaming performance and Windows on ARM’s software compatibility. The panel noted that the device is likely a niche, high-end product rather than a mainstream gaming machine, serving as a stepping stone for Nvidia’s ambitions in ARM-based PCs rather than a reinvention of the Windows PC experience.
Next, the discussion covered the pricing and viability of the upcoming Steam Machine in light of recent Steam Deck price increases. The team expressed uncertainty about the Steam Machine’s final cost but suggested that building a custom PC might offer better value and performance. They acknowledged the Steam Machine’s appeal as a compact, all-in-one device running SteamOS but emphasized that DIY or pre-built PCs could provide more flexibility and potentially lower prices, especially given current hardware market conditions.
